The Earth Protectors magazine met with Prof. Dr. Mahmoud El-Metini, President of Ain Shams University, at the graduation ceremony of the “Training Program for African and Egyptian Climate Ambassadors”. He began his dialogue by welcoming Prof. Dr. Minister of Manpower Mohamed Saafan, the President of the Association of African Universities, the Consul General and Deputy Ambassador of the State of Sudan, and the representatives of the Environment Ministers. In light of Egypt’s preparations to host the Climate Summit Conference (Cop27), he commented: “The topics now revolve around green transformation and sustainability, especially after the Climate Summit Conference (Cop26) and the momentum and intense interest that occurred around it, and the Egyptian state is fully prepared and equipped to host the Climate Summit Conference (Cop27) in light of theEgypt Vision 2030 He also praised the efforts made and the great interest of the political leadership and concerned parties in achieving sustainability.”

He concluded his speech by expressing his happiness with the university’s achievements, especially the College of Graduate Studies and Environmental Research, led by Professor Dr. Noha Samir Donia. Because of its great achievements in achieving the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s), and thanked all the attendees.
Also at the graduation ceremony, we also met with Mr. Professor Dr. Mohamed Saafan, Minister of Manpower, and he began his speech by expressing his gratitude for being invited to such a large ceremony, and said: “This program is one of the results and outputs of the (Get Green) initiative under the auspices of Mr. President Abdel Fattah El-Sisi, President of the Republic, to mobilize African and Egyptian students and researchers to build climate knowledge assets with society and raise environmental awareness, in preparation for receiving the Conference of the Parties (COP) to the United Nations Convention.” United Nations Climate Change Action Committee (Cop27) in Sharm El-Sheikh next November."
Then he continued, saying: “In order to achieve Egypt’s Vision 2030 and move Egypt towards a green and sustainable future, and to achieve justice between different generations in the distribution of natural resources, to ensure the continuation of the development process, this must be done through three dimensions: the economic dimension, the social dimension, and the environmental dimension, and the contribution of all parties under the umbrella of the sustainable development strategies of Egypt’s Vision 2030, as this sustainability will not be achieved unless Through a strong commitment to partnerships and cooperation at the local and international levels.
He concluded his meeting with an important message: “We must first care and rely on humans; Going green is for man and by man.”
At the conclusion of the ceremony, one of its most important results is the joint cooperation between the Ministry of Environment, the Ministry of Social Solidarity, the Ministry of Finance, and Ain Shams University; To benefit and transfer expertise in light of Egypt’s Vision 2030; To achieve sustainable development and go green, and in the end, Professor Dr. Mahmoud El-Metini presented the university’s shield to the attendees, and thanked them for their efforts, wishing them success and continued efforts to spread awareness of sustainable development.
